Feb 15, 2017 (newstodate): Georgia's capital airport, Tbilisi International Airport will welcome a new airline operator from this summer.
The Kuwaiti airline Gulf Air has announced its plans for launching flights between Kuwait and Tbilisi from June 22, 2017, offering three weekly rotations with Airbus A320 aircraft.
The initial plans comprise so far only flights during this summer schedule, ending in October 2017.
